The first International Conference on Therapeutic Touch is scheduled to be held in Boston (Cambridge) from April 24-26, 2009. Therapeutic Touch is a holistic form of energy treatment used by nurses and other practitioners as an integrative therapy.

Letting Everything Become Your Teacher: 100 Lessons in Mindfulness |
|
In his new book, Letting Everything Become Your Teacher, Jon Kabat-Zinn explore the use of informal mindfulness meditation in our everyday lives. The book draws on his previous books, especially Full Catastrophe Living, to examine how awareness of the present moment, as our lives unfold, becomes our constant teacher.
